What do you call someone who is afraid of medicine?

Iatrophobia causes you to fear doctors or medical tests. You may avoid seeking medical care even when you’re very sick because you have extreme anxiety or panic attacks.

How do I stop being scared of pills?

Primary Care

  1. Make sure you have plenty of water.
  2. Practice with a Tic Tac or small piece of candy or food to help overcome the fear of swallowing.
  3. Turn your head to either side while swallowing, which can help.
  4. Before cutting or crushing a pill, always check with a pharmacist.
  5. Always read the labels.

What is Somniphobia?

Somniphobia is an irrational fear of sleep. People may worry throughout the day about not being able to sleep. This worry can cause difficulties with focus or concentration. Often, somniphobia arises from a fear of having nightmares or experiencing sleep paralysis.

What is the fear of swallowing pills called?

Choking phobia is a rare condition characterized by intense fear of choking accompanied by avoidance of swallowing solid food, liquids and taking pills/ tablets in the absence of anatomical or physiological abnormalities.

Can u crush ibuprofen?

Swallow ibuprofen tablets or capsules whole with a drink of water, milk or juice. Do not chew, break, crush or suck them as this could irritate your mouth or throat.
